Maple Leaf is a Canadian Company, they are the largest supplier of meat in Canada. They buy from local vendors and promote themselves in local community events. They admitted to the problem, they are aware of how it happened, and I believe that they are doing their best to avoid repeating this from happening again.

Us Canadians have become dependent on processed meat and the only alternative is to buy from our neighbours to the South.

I am willing to give Maple Leaf foods another chance.

Companies make mistakes. I don't think for one moment that anyone at Maple Leaf Foods wanted that outbreak to occur. The irony is that at the time, the company was undergoing some cost saving measures in order to compete with products brought in from China and other countries. This of course was due to consumer demand for lower prices across the board. I always, at the end of the day, place much of the blame on the 'blissfully ignorant' consumer. It's their $$$ that dictate how companies behave. In the end the consumer gets what they pay for.

Anyway, my opinion is similar to Tungstens. Buy their products and move on.

Wallace and Archie McCain split up the family potato fortune.
Archie got $1B from OTPF to buy MLF. He promptly shut down all the primary pork producing plants and laid off all the unionized workers and recinded the collective bargaining agreement. He immediately opened the plants again and offered everyone their jobs back at 2/3 salary. All this with the full backing of the Ontario Teacher's Union.
